World Net Daily wrote about our lawsuit, suing the organizations and individuals who engaged in traffic blockades in Washington, D.C.

The keffiyeh-clad activists chained themselves together in the middle of highways while others linked arms with PVC pipes, forming human chains to block roads. Many of the activists held signs that said, “From the River to the Sea, Palestine Must be Free,” and chanted slogans including “We Don’t Want No Jewish State” and “If We Don’t Get It, Shut It Down!”

The Hamilton Lincoln Law Institute filed its lawsuit Friday on behalf of Daniel Faoro, who was trapped by the blockade. They called the traffic jam “perhaps the most disruptive action by anti-Israel activists” and said commuters “were trapped in their vehicles with no inkling as to when their freedom of movement would be restored.”
